Tungiasis (sand flea disease) is a neglected tropical disease that is endemic in Sub-Saharan Africa and Latin America. Tungiasis causes pain, mobility restrictions, stigmatisation and reduced quality of life. Very severe cases with hundreds of sand fleas have been described, but treatment of such cases has never been studied systematically. During a larger community-based tungiasis control programme in a hyperendemic region in Karamoja, northeastern Uganda, 96 very severe tungiasis cases were identified and treated with the dimeticone formula NYDA®. They were repeatedly followed-up and treated again when necessary. The present study traces tungiasis frequency, intensity and morbidity among these 96 individuals over 2 years. At baseline, very severe tungiasis occurred in all age groups, including young children. Throughout the intervention, tungiasis frequency decreased from 100% to 25.8% among the 96 individuals. The overall number of embedded sand fleas in this group dropped from 15,648 to 158, and the median number of embedded sand fleas among the tungiasis cases decreased from 141 to four. Walking difficulties were reported in 96.9% at the beginning and in 4.5% at the end of the intervention. Repeated treatment with the dimeticone formula over 2 years was a successful strategy to manage very severe cases in a hyperendemic community. Treatment of very severe cases is essential to control the spread and burden of tungiasis in endemic communities.

CONTEXT: Tungiasis is a neglected tropical skin disease endemic in resource-poor communities. It is caused by the penetration of the female sand flea, Tunga penetrans, into the skin causing immense pain, itching, difficulty walking, sleeping and concentrating on school or work. Infection is associated with living in a house with unsealed earthen house floors. METHODS: This feasibility study used a community-based co-creation approach to develop and test simple, locally appropriate, and affordable flooring solutions to create a sealed, washable floor for the prevention of tungiasis. Locally used techniques were explored and compared in small slab trials. The floor with best strength and lowest cost was pilot trialed in 12 households with tungiasis cases to assess its durability and costs, feasibility of installation in existing local houses using local masons and explore community perceptions. Disease outcomes were measured to estimate potential impact. RESULTS: It was feasible to build the capacity of a community-based organization to conduct research, develop a low-cost floor and conduct a pilot trial. The optimal low-cost floor was stabilized local subsoil with cement at a 1:9 ratio, installed as a 5 cm depth slab. A sealed floor was associated with a lower mean infection intensity among infected children than in control households (aIRR 0.53, 95%CI 0.29-0.97) when adjusted for covariates. The cost of the new floor was US$3/m2 compared to $10 for a concrete floor. Beneficiaries reported the floor made their lives much easier, enabled them to keep clean and children to do their schoolwork and eat while sitting on the floor. Challenges encountered indicate future studies would need intensive mentoring of masons to ensure the floor is properly installed and households supervised to ensure the floor is properly cured. CONCLUSION: This study provided promising evidence that retrofitting simple cement-stabilised soil floors with locally available materials is a feasible option for tungiasis control and can be implemented through training of community-based organisations. Disease outcome data is promising and suggests that a definitive trial is warranted. Data generated will inform the design of a fully powered randomized trial combined with behaviour change communications. TRIAL REGISTRATION: ISRCTN 62801024 (retrospective 07.07.2023).

Tunga penetrans, Tunga trimamillata and Tunga hexalobulata are the three species of sand fleas which cause tungiasis in domestic animals. Tunga penetrans and T. trimamillata are zoonotic in the tropical and sub-tropical endemic communities of Latin America and Africa. Tungiasis in animals frequently occurs alongside human tungiasis. Currently, most of the attention given to tungiasis is focusing on the human disease, and animal tungiasis is extremely neglected despite its public health and animal health significance. This review highlights recent findings concerning the clinical implications and treatment options but also summarises the occurrence, major features, public health and economic significance of tungiasis in domestic animals. Pigs, dogs, cats and domestic ruminants have been reported to harbour high intensities of sand fleas in endemic communities. High infection intensities cause significant animal morbidity which is often exacerbated by excoriations and secondary bacterial infections which are potentially fatal. In addition to the potential economic losses accruing from tungiasis-related morbidity, infected domestic animals contribute to transmission and persistence of sand fleas and eventually also to severe human disease. Although control of animal tungiasis is possible by adoption of proper husbandry practices, affected communities may not afford the resources required to implement them. Also, there are no widely acceptable and affordable insecticides for treatment of tungiasis in animals. Extension services aiming at increasing awareness on tungiasis and its control should be intensified. Also, available commercial insecticides should be evaluated for therapeutic and prophylactic properties against animal tungiasis.

Tungiasis is a public health problem in endemic resource-poor communities, where dogs are important reservoirs of Tunga spp., contributing significantly to the process of transmission of this zoonosis. In order to optimize the diagnosis of canine tungiasis, macroscopic morphological characteristics and clinical signs of the lesions were investigated, based on the inspection of 40 dogs infested by T. penetrans from an endemic rural community in northeastern Brazil. Of the 1546 lesions found in these dogs, including all stages of development of the parasite, 89.1% (1378) were located on the paw pads. Dogs aged up to 5 years had the greatest number of lesions. Dark pigmentation and hyperkeratosis of the paw pads made it difficult to identify the lesions. Among all the clinical signs observed were hyperemia (38; 95%), pain (32; 80%), fissure (11; 27.5%), onychogryphosis (29; 72.5%), cluster of lesions (26; 65%), hyperkeratosis (25; 62.5%), lameness (15; 37.5%), and fissure (11; 27.5%). Ectopic lesions were found especially in the nipples (64; 4.1%) and abdomen (51; 3.3%). The maximum diameter of the stage III neosomes was 6 mm. Dogs with a higher number of lesions had a higher degree of hyperkeratosis. Age over 1 year was associated with a higher rate of dispersion of the parasite in the environment (p = 0.04). The identification of the initial stages of tungiasis can guarantee a more effective control of the disease in dogs, which will mainly depend on the treatment of adult animals and the application of continuous preventive actions based on One Health in these communities.

BACKGROUND: Tungiasis is a neglected neotropical disease caused by penetration of Tunga spp. into the skin of the host. METHODS: Two primates were rescued from nearby different indigenous villages, and the clinical, pathological, and parasitological features of tungiasis were described. Flea identification occurred through their morphometry and was confirmed with the use of a dichotomous key. RESULTS: Monkey 1 was parasitized by 23 sand fleas and, after treatment, was assigned to the animal rehabilitation center. Monkey 2 was in poor body condition and died shortly after clinical examination. At necropsy, this primate was parasitized by 26 specimens of sand fleas. CONCLUSIONS: Both animals altered their tree behavior by staying on the ground for long periods. This parasitic relationship implies the possibility of enlargement of the sand flea dispersion. Thus, this is the first record of Tunga penetrans occurrence in wild Alouatta guariba clamitans.

Pediculosis is an infestation of lice on the body, head, or pubic region that occurs worldwide. Lice are ectoparasites of the order Phthiraptera that feed on the blood of infested hosts. Their morphotype dictates their clinical features. Body lice may transmit bacterial pathogens that cause trench fever, relapsing fever, and epidemic typhus, which are potentially life-threatening diseases that remain relevant in contemporary times. Recent data from some settings suggest that head lice may harbor pathogens. The epidemiology, clinical manifestations, and management of body, head, and pubic louse infestation are reviewed. New therapies for head lice and screening considerations for pubic lice are discussed. Tungiasis is an ectoparasitic disease caused by skin penetration by the female Tunga penetrans or, less commonly, Tunga trimamillata flea. It is endemic in Latin America, the Caribbean and sub-Saharan Africa and seen in travelers returning from these regions. Risk factors for acquiring tungiasis, associated morbidity, and potential strategies for prevention and treatment are discussed.

BACKGROUND: Tungiasis is an infestation caused by the penetration into the skin of the flea Tunga penetrans. Histopathologic studies on imported tungiasis are rare and based on a limited number of cases. METHODS: We carried out a review of 39 biopsy specimens collected from 39 patients with imported tungiasis. In all patients, ethnicity, gender, age, location, and clinical features of the lesions, Fortaleza classification and countries of infestation were recorded. RESULTS: Histopathologic study revealed hyper- parakeratosis and acanthosis. Fragments of the flea were located in the epidermis and upper dermis and were circumscribed by a pseudo-cystic cavity. Inside this cavity, we observed: the exoskeleton, made up of a thickened and eosinophilic cuticle; the striated muscle; the tracheal rings and the digestive organs (observed only in some specimens); the ovaries, very rich in eggs, and an inflammatory infiltrate, made up of lymphocytes and neutrophils, with numerous eosinophils. The hypodermic layer was never observed. CONCLUSION: Histopathologic examination is helpful for the correct diagnosis of tungiasis in travelers returning from tropical and subtropical countries in which the infestation may be characterized by an atypical clinical presentation.

BACKGROUND: Tungiasis is a relatively frequent ectoparasitosis in low-income settings, yet its morbidity and social impact are still not well understood due to the scarcity of information. In Rwanda, data on the magnitude and conditions leading to the tungiasis is rare. This study sought to determine the prevalence and factors associated with tungiasis among primary school children in Rwandan setting. METHOD: A descriptive cross-sectional study utilising systematic random sampling method was adopted to select 384 children from three primary schools. From July to October 2018, data were collected on socio-demographic characteristics of children, parents, and households. Logistic regression was applied to analyse socio-demographic factors associated with tungiasis with a level of significance set at P-value< 0.05. RESULTS: Prevalence of tungiasis among three primary schools was 23%. Factors associated with tungiasis included walking barefoot (AOR: 78.41; 95% CI: 17.91-343.10), irregular wearing of shoes (AOR: 24.73; 95% CI: 6.27-97.41), having dirty feet (AOR: 12.69; 95% CI: 4.93-32.64), wearing dirty clothes (AOR: 12.69; 95% CI: 4.18-38.50), and living in a house with earthen plastered floor (AOR: 28.79; 95% CI: 7.11-116.57). Children infected with tungiasis attended class less frequently (AOR: 19.16, 95%CI: 7.20-50.97) and scored lower (AOR: 110.85, 95%CI: 43.08-285.20) than those non-infected. The low school attendance and poor performance could be partly explained by difficulty of walking, lack of concentration during school activities, and isolation or discrimination from classmates. CONCLUSION: Tungiasis was a public health challenge among school going children in a rural Rwandan setting. This study revealed that children affected with tungiasis had poor hygiene, inadequate housing environments and consequently poor school attendance and performance. Improving socio-economic conditions of households with special emphasis on hygiene of family members and housing conditions, would contribute to preventing tungiasis.

Tungiasis is a zoonosis neglected by authorities, health professionals, and affected populations. Domestic, synanthropic, and sylvatic animals serve as reservoirs for human infestation, and dogs are usually considered a main reservoir in endemic communities. To describe the seasonal variation and the persistence of tungiasis in dogs, we performed quarterly surveys during a period of 2 years in a tourist village in the municipality of Ilhéus, Bahia State, known to be endemic for tungiasis. Prevalence in dogs ranged from 62.1% (43/66) in August 2013 to 82.2% (37/45) in November 2014, with no significant difference (p = 0.06). The prevalence of infestation remained high, regardless of rainfall patterns. Of the 31 dogs inspected at all surveys, period prevalence was 94% (29/31; 95% CI 79.3-98.2%) and persistence of infestation indicator [PII] was high (median PII = 6 surveys, q1 = 5, q3 = 7). Dogs < 1 year of age had a higher mean prevalence of 84.5%, as compared with 69.3% in the older dogs. No significant difference was found between the risk of infestation and age or sex (p = 0.61). Our data indicate that canine tungiasis persisted in the area during all periods of the year. The seasonal variation described in human studies from other endemic areas was not observed, most probably due to different rainfall patterns throughout the year. The study has important implications for the planning of integrated control measures in both humans and animal reservoirs, considering a One Health approach.

BACKGROUND: Tungiasis is an ectoparasitic infestation, which still has public health importance in deprived populations of developing countries. Data on the prevalence and risk factors of tungiasis is rare in Ethiopia. Hence, this study was designed to determine the prevalence and risk factors of tungiasis among children in Wensho district, southern Ethiopia. METHODS: From February to May 2016, we conducted a community-based cross-sectional study on 366 children 5-14 years old. Data about the presence and severity of tungiasis were obtained through inspection and data on risk factors were collected through interviews of parents/guardians of the children using structured questionnaire and through observation of the housing environment using structured checklist. RESULTS: Two hundred fifteen (58.7%, 95% confidence interval [CI]: 53.7%, 63.8%) of the 366 children were infested with Tunga penetrans. Most lesions were localized in the feet and the distribution of the disease by sex was similar (57.4% among males and 60.3% among females). Children of illiterate mothers (adjusted odds ratio [AOR]: 3.62, 95% CI: 1.35, 9.73) and children whose mothers have attended only primary education (AOR: 2.72, 95% CI: 1.06, 6.97), children from cat owning households (AOR: 4.95, 95% CI: 1.19, 20.60) and children who occasionally use footwear (AOR: 7.42, 95% CI: 4.29, 12.83) and those who never use footwear (AOR: 12.55, 95% CI: 3.38, 46.58) had a significantly higher odds of tungiasis infestation. CONCLUSION: Tungiasis is an important public health problem with considerable morbidity among children in Wensho. Hence, implementation of tungiasis prevention strategies such as promoting shoes wearing, provision of health education, fumigating the residential houses and applying insecticides on pets are recommended.

BACKGROUND: Towards the improvement of stakeholders' awareness of animal tungiasis, we report 10 unusual severe clinical cases of pig tungiasis which were associated with very high infection intensities of T. penetrans in an endemic area. RESULTS: Morbidity of ten pigs with high sand flea intensities detected during high transmission seasons in an endemic area in Busoga sub region, Uganda is described in detail. The cases of pigs presented with a very high number of embedded sand fleas (median = 276, range = 141-838). Acute manifestations due to severe tungiasis included ulcerations (n = 10), abscess formation (n = 6) and lameness (n = 9). Chronic morphopathological presentations were overgrowth of claws (n = 5), lateral deviation of dew claws (n = 6), detachment (n = 5) or loss of dew claws (n = 1). Treatment of severe cases with a topical insecticidal aerosol containing chlorfenvinphos, dichlorvos and gentian violet resolved acute morbidity and facilitated healing by re-epithelialisation. CONCLUSIONS: The presentations of tungiasis highlighted in this report show that high intensities of embedded T. penetrans can cause a severe clinical disease in pigs. Effective tungiasis preventive measures and early diagnosis for treatment could be crucial to minimize its effects on animal health.

Tungiasis ensues from the penetration and burrowing of female sand fleas (Tunga spp.; Siphonaptera: Tungidae) in the skin of mammals. There are few case reports of severe tungiasis in goats and in these cases the Tunga species were not in most cases clearly identified. Two cases of severe tungiasis caused by Tunga penetrans in goat kids from tungiasis-endemic rural Uganda are reported. These are the first severe cases of tungiasis in goats reported from outside South America.

BACKGROUND: Brazil will host the 2014 FIFA World Cup and the 2016 Olympic and Paralympic Games, events that are expected to attract hundreds of thousands of international travelers. Travelers to Brazil will encounter locally endemic infections as well as mass event-specific risks. METHODS: We describe 1586 ill returned travelers who had visited Brazil and were seen at a GeoSentinel Clinic from July 1997 through May 2013. RESULTS: The most common travel-related illnesses were dermatologic conditions (40%), diarrheal syndromes (25%), and febrile systemic illness (19%). The most common specific dermatologic diagnoses were cutaneous larva migrans, myiasis, and tungiasis. Dengue and malaria, predominantly Plasmodium vivax, were the most frequently identified specific causes of fever and the most common reasons for hospitalization after travel. Dengue fever diagnoses displayed marked seasonality, although cases were seen throughout the year. Among the 28 ill returned travelers with human immunodeficiency virus (HIV) infection, 11 had newly diagnosed asymptomatic infection and 9 had acute symptomatic HIV. CONCLUSIONS: Our analysis primarily identified infectious diseases among travelers to Brazil. Knowledge of illness in travelers returning from Brazil can assist clinicians to advise prospective travelers and guide pretravel preparation, including itinerary-tailored advice, vaccines, and chemoprophylaxis; it can also help to focus posttravel evaluation of ill returned travelers. Travelers planning to attend mass events will encounter other risks that are not captured in our surveillance network.

Tunga is the most specialized genus among the Siphonaptera because adult females penetrate into the skin of their hosts and, after mating and fertilization, undergo hypertrophy, forming an enlarged structure known as the neosome. In humans and other warm-blooded animals, neosomes cause tungiasis, which arises due to the action of opportunistic agents. Although its effects on humans and domestic animals are well described in the literature, little is known about the impact of tungiasis on wild animals. This review focuses on the morphology, taxonomy, geographical distribution, hosts, prevalence, sites of attachment, and impact of tungid neosomes on wild and domestic animals. Because neosomes are the most characteristic form of the genus Tunga and also the form most frequently found in hosts, they are here differentiated and illustrated to aid in the identification of the 13 currently known species. Perspectives for future studies regarding the possibility of discovering other sand flea species, adaptation to new hosts, and the transfer of tungids between hosts in natural and modified habitats are also presented.

BACKGROUND: The sand flea Tunga penetrans usually infects the feet and affects primary school-age children and elderly persons in rural Uganda. Tungiasis occurs nationwide but disease outbreaks have been reported in the Busoga sub-Region of eastern Uganda, associated with poor sanitation and proximity between humans and domestic animals. Ectopic tungiasis, usually seen with extensive infection and at weight-bearing body surfaces often follows exposure in highly infested environments. For patients who present abroad treatment may be surgical excision or amputation. CASE PRESENTATION: An adult female Musoga by tribe, resident in a Kampala City suburb presented at Mulago National Referral and Teaching Hospital's Oral Surgery and Jaw Injuries Unit with a discoloured swollen tongue, facial cellulitis and submandibular lymphadenopathy. A swelling palpable in the body of her tongue was excised and sent for histology. Tungiasis of the tongue was diagnosed after microscopic examination of formalin-fixed paraffin-embedded Haematoxylin and Eosin-stained tissue sections. CONCLUSION: Lingual tungiasis is a rare diagnosis that was made on histological examination. Atypical presentation outside an endemic area predisposed the patient to partial glossectomy instead of the less invasive flea enucleation. Ectopic disease in a city-resident highlights the plight not only of visitors to infested areas but also of the communities and their domestic animals.
